BANGKOK, 8 January 2015 – The National Legislative Assembly has resolved to accept the draft amendment of the law on the organization of the military court. 

On Thursday, the NLA meeting chaired by Mr. Pornpetch Wichitcholchai reviewed the draft amendment of the Act for the Organization of the Military Court, which was presented by Deputy Defense Minister Gen. Udomdej Sitabutr.staff

According to Gen. Udomdej, the amendment is needed because the original law, the Act for the Organization of the Military Court B.E. 2498, has been in effect for a long time and become outdated due to the change in the structure and the current operations of the military.

In the proposed amendment, the staff judge advocates and the military prosecutors will receive a more acceptable amount of remuneration, appropriate for their roles and duties.

The NLA members voted 189 to one, with two abstentions, to accept the draft and agreed to set up a 15-member special committee to review it
